  • Patent number: 5886789
    Abstract: A surface testing device, operating by reflection, for linearly moving, tape-like materials, for example paper or polymer films, is suitable for automatic online registration of linear irregularities transverse to the direction of movement. The testing device includes a suitable test distance, at least two optical inspection units and at least one electronic circuit arrangement for detecting both the individual signals of the inspection units and the coincidence signals. In addition, a magnetic information medium wound in the form of a roll on a hub is tested by the surface testing device and carries a machine-readable and/or visually readable quality identification.

  • Patent number: 5256497
    Abstract: It has been found that a magnetic tape which may be used in particular for video recording and which has excellent abrasive and cleaning properties for all those parts of the cassette or rather the recording and play-back unit which come into contact with the magnetic layer can be obtained by addition of a non-magnetic powder having a Mohs' hardness of at least 9 and a primary particle size of 0.3 to 2 .mu.m to the magnetic pigment, which has a BET surface of at least 26 m.sup.2 /g, in the magnetic dispersion, the magnetic layer of the magnetic tape having an Ra value of less than 0.02 .mu.m. The best results were obtained with cubic Al.sub.2 O.sub.3 particles added in a quantity of 1.1 to 4.4% by weight, based on the magnetic pigment.
